We are seeking a Contract Administrator (CM Project Administrator) to join our Southern, CA team! Come join us!

Job respon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Receive, manage, and maintain project documents.
  • Respond to records requests; prepare project files and administrative records for final closeout and retention.
  • Perform broad range of administrative duties, including procurements, billings, insurance,
    badging, and compliance.
  • Work with project management team to ensure project compliance with client, city, state, and Federal contractual terms.

Requirements

Minimum Requirements:

  • Bachelor's or Masters degree in relevant discipline such as Architecture, Engineering, Business, or Legal field.
  • Experience with project management software, preferred
  • Certifications for document control professionals, preferred
  • Experience in the administration of commercial/government contracts, and with document processing and data management.
    -0-5 years' experience for Junior Level
    -5-10 years' experience for Mid-Level, and
    -15+ years' experience for Senior Level
